- definition
- (of a vehicle or its driver) move out from the side of the road, or from its normal position in order to pass:"as he turned the corner a police car pulled out in front of him"
- (of a bus or train) leave with its passengers:"the train pulled out of the station at 2:05"
- withdraw from an undertaking:"he was forced to pull out of the championship because of an injury"
- retreat from an area:"the army pulled out, leaving the city in ruins"Similar:give way/groundretreat fromstop participating inback out ofbow out ofrenege on
- cause to retreat from an area:"the CIA had pulled its operatives out of Tripoli"Similar:give way/groundretreat fromstop participating inback out ofbow out ofrenege on
- (during sexual intercourse) withdraw the penis from the vagina prior to ejaculation:"just because you're “positive” you can pull out in time doesn't mean you shouldn't be using protection"
adjectivepull-out (adjective)- designed to be pulled out of the usual position:"pullout wire baskets at the bottom of one cupboard"
- (of a section of a magazine, newspaper, or other publication) designed to be detached and kept.
